What Does a Mole on the Ear Represent Astrologically

In Chinese face reading, the ear represents the early years of life, often from birth to adolescence. A well-shaped ear with a mole is usually seen as a sign of good fortune, intelligence, and strong family backing. When a mole appears on the ear, it often suggests that the person receives support from elders, teachers, or influential figures during important stages of life.

Chinese interpretations also connect ear moles with financial awareness. Individuals with such marks are believed to handle money carefully and develop stability over time. The earlobe, in particular, symbolizes wealth and prosperity. A mole here may indicate accumulation of assets or a comfortable lifestyle.

Samudrika Shastra, an ancient Indian system of physiognomy, approaches this from a slightly different angle. It links the ear to knowledge, memory, and karmic learning. A mole on the ear can reflect past life impressions connected to communication, listening, or intellectual growth. Some texts suggest that such individuals carry lessons related to speech, truth, and decision-making.

Both systems agree on one central idea. The ear connects to how we receive and process information. A mole in this area often highlights a life path influenced by awareness, wisdom, and internal reflection.

Cultural or Religious Interpretations

Across different cultures, the meaning of a mole on the ear reflects a blend of symbolism, observation, and belief. While the details vary, certain themes appear consistently.

In Chinese traditions, the ear is seen as a reflection of early life fortune and inherited traits. A mole here often connects to intelligence, longevity, and the influence of family background. The shape and size of the ear itself also play a role in interpretation, reinforcing the idea that physical features can reflect life patterns.

In Indian traditions, particularly within Samudrika Shastra, the ear is associated with wisdom and karma. Marks on the ear are believed to carry insights into past actions and their influence on present circumstances. This perspective places emphasis on personal growth and the unfolding of life lessons over time.

In some Middle Eastern beliefs, a mole on the ear is linked to heightened awareness. It may suggest a person who perceives more than what is immediately visible, whether in social situations or spiritual contexts.

Certain African traditions interpret ear markings as signs of ancestral connection. This view suggests that the individual may receive guidance from lineage or spiritual heritage, creating a sense of continuity between past and present.

In Western folklore, ear moles are sometimes associated with secrecy or discretion. The earโ€™s role in listening contributes to the idea that these individuals may be trusted with important information.

Buddhist symbolism, while not directly focused on moles, often highlights long or prominent earlobes as signs of wisdom and enlightenment. This broader association reinforces the connection between the ear and higher understanding.

Myths and Superstitions Associated with Mole on the Ear

Over time, storytelling has shaped many beliefs about ear moles, blending observation with imagination.

One common idea suggests that individuals with a mole on the ear naturally attract secrets. People may feel comfortable confiding in them, which aligns with the symbolic link between the ear and listening.

Another widespread belief connects ear moles to financial growth later in life. This idea often appears in cultures where the earlobe is associated with wealth and prosperity.

There are also interpretations that divide meaning based on left and right placement. Some traditions claim that a mole on the left ear indicates emotional challenges, while the right ear points to success. These interpretations vary widely and often reflect cultural biases rather than consistent patterns.

A persistent superstition suggests that altering or removing a mole could affect oneโ€™s luck. While this has no scientific support, it reflects the deeper belief that physical marks are tied to fate or destiny.

Some cultures associate ear moles with spiritual protection, suggesting that unseen forces may guide or support the individual. Others interpret a mole behind the ear as a sign of hidden talents that emerge over time.
